Big Day Comin' At Bellerive
After opening rounds of 67-67=134 (-6), Brian Gay is -4 today through 15 holes (-10 for the tournament) and in solo third place. Jay Williamson, the other contender on the LBG Leaderboard, has completed three rounds with 68-69-72=209 (-1 and T-37).

Round 3 of the BMW Championship has been suspended due to darkness. Play will resume at 7:30am local time. Round 4 is scheduled to begin between 10:00am - 12:00pm on both the 1st and 10th tee.

To say that tomorrow's play is critical is an understatement. The Top 30 in FedExCup points earn a spot in next week's final Playoff event -- The TOUR Championship in Atlanta -- and a shot at the richest prize in professional golf. The rest go fishing.

As of last week, Brian ranked 58th with 98,385 points. But, should he sustain his brilliant play this week -- -- he is projected to win 5,400 points and move up 35 spots to 23rd (103,785 points). http://www.pgatour.com/r/stats/curre...ections-1.html



Which of course, would put him in next week's field.

Tough Sunday
Brian closed with a 2-over 72 on Sunday. For the week, he shot 273, 7-under, and his T13 finish earned $131,250.

Jay Williamson finished at 2-over 282, good for T52 and a check for $16,520.
